What is Revolve Group's price / book?
Revolve Group (RVLV) reported price / book of 2.8× in Q2 2024.
How has Revolve Group's price / book changed year-over-year?
Revolve Group's price / book decreased by 6.0% year-over-year, from 3× to 2.8×.
What is the long-term trend for Revolve Group's price / book?
Over 3 years (2020 to 2023), Revolve Group's price / book has grown at a -35.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from 11.4× to 3.1×.
What does price / book mean?
Market capitalization at the quarter end divided by shareholders' equity. The premium (or discount) the market assigns to the company's book equity.
